Strawberry Dream Cookies Recipe
Kristan Roland
Strawberry Dream Cookies are exactly that – a dream. With a delectable frosting and all the sprinkles you could handle, they’re Valentine’s Day perfection.
Prep Time 45 minutes mins
Cook Time 10 minutes mins
Total Time 55 minutes mins
Servings 36 1 cookie
Calories 205 kcal
8 ounces Cream Cheese softened 1 stick Salted Butter softened, 1/2 cup 1 large Egg 1 box Strawberry Cake Mix 1/3 cup Powdered Sugar 12 tablespoons Salted Butter softened, 3/4 cup 4 ounces Cream Cheese softened, half a block 1/3 cup Frozen Sweetened Strawberries in Syrup thawed and pureed 2 teaspoons Lemon Juice 4 cups Powdered Sugar Sprinkles
Preheat oven to 350°F. Line baking sheet with parchment paper and set aside.
In the bowl of your mixer, beat cream cheese and butter on medium speed, scraping sides of bowl as needed, until combined and smooth.
Beat in the egg.
Add cake mix and beat on medium until a smooth dough forms.
Using a medium cookie scoop, scoop dough into balls and roll in powdered sugar. Place on prepared baking sheets, roughly 2 inches apart.
Bake for 10 minutes, or until edges and bottoms of cookies are just barely golden.
Let cool on baking sheet for 5 minutes before removing to wire rack to cool completely.
In the bowl of your mixer, beat butter and cream cheese on medium speed until smooth.
Add pureed strawberry mixture and lemon juice, beating on low until smooth.
Add powdered sugar and continue beating on low until JUST combined.
Increase mixer speed to high and beat for one minute.
Generously frost cookies and top with sprinkles, if desired.
